Book 6-3.S Page 3b5 ReA-g-J_..._L__.2_,. . • f J• S30-146-/• f `/y1;u �,a�f 44 '' d,.;•L AN ORDINANCE r_h i'Al 1t/ AN ORDINANCE VACATING alley beginning at a point on the south side of Ramona Avenue, 115 feet east of 7th East Street, running thence south, thence east to Lake Street,in Salt Lake City,Utah. Be it ordained by the Board of Commissioners of Salt Lake City, Utah: SECTION I. That alley beginning at a point on the south side of Ra- mona Avenue, 115 feet east of 7th East Street, running thence south, thence east to Lake Street, In Salt Lake City, Utah, more particularly described as follows: Beginning at the southeast corner of Lot 9,Clear View Sub.of Blk.2, 5-Acre Plat A",Big Field Survey, thence south 12 ft.,thence west 215 ft., thence north 130.5 ft., thence east 10 ft., thence south 108.5 ft., thence S.45 deg.E.14.14 ft.,thence • east 195 ft.to the place of beginning; be and the some is hereby vacated and declared no longer to be public property for use street,avenue alley or pedestrians a a Said vacation is w made de expressly subject to all existing rights of way and easements of all public utilities of any and every description n w lo- cated in.on,under orover the eon. fines of the above described prop- erty and also subject to the right of entry thereon for the purpose of In- specting,maintaining, epairing,re- moving. r replacing,altering put- tog said utilities and all of them. SECTION 2.In the opinion of the Board of Commissioners.it is neces- sary to the peace,health and safety f the inhabitants of Salt Lake City that this ordinance shall become ef- fective immediately. SECTION 3.This ordinance shag take effect upon its first publication. • Passed by the Board of Commis- sioners of Salt Lake City,Utah,on the 24th day of April,A.D.,1947. EARL J.GLADE, Mayor. IRMA F.
